About Eduan Wilkinson

Eduan Wilkinson is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Virology, Epidemiology, Molecular Biology and Ecology, having authored 48 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V Research and Treatment (21 papers), H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(16 papers), SARS-CoV-2 and COVID-19 Research (11 papers), H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(10 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(7 papers),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(6 papers), HIV, Drug Use, Sexual Risk (5 papers) and Hepatitis B Virus Studies (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(238 citations), Infectious Diseases (460 citations), Modeling and Simulation (27 citations), Animal Science and Zoology (57 citations) and Ecology (141 citations). Eduan Wilkinson has collaborated with scholars based in South Africa,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Túlio de Oliveira, Jean-Baka Domelevo Entfellner, Miraine Dávila Felipe, Frédéric Lemoine, Olivier Gascuel, Susan Engelbrecht, Richard Lessells, Houriiyah Tegally, Benjamin Chimukangara and Maryam Fish. Their work appears in journals such as Viruses, PLoS ONE, AIDS Research and Human Retroviruses, Infection Genetics and Evolution and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
